NEUROPHET Inc.: 10 Years of Electronic Drug Clinical Trials... Revenue Has Begun

According to the company on the 9th, full-scale revenue has recently begun to flow in the “digital therapeutics” market. This marks the culmination, after 10 years, of the brain electrical stimulation therapy technology the company has been developing since its inception. Although revenue is currently in the hundreds of millions of won range, CEO Bin Jun-gil explained that the future potential is significant.

Bin Jun-gil, CEO of NEUROPHET Inc., said, “This isn’t a new venture we’ve recently expanded into; it’s a business we’ve been pursuing since our founding,” adding, “It took 10 years—from the release of our research software in 2018, to obtaining Class 3 approval for our tDCS device in 2021, and finally to our designation as an innovative medical technology last year.”

NEUROPHET Inc.’s personalized transcranial direct current stimulation (tDCS) solution was designated as an innovative medical technology last year. It was recognized for its ability to aid in the recovery of patients who have lost motor function in their fingers due to stroke. As a result, it will be available for exclusive use in clinical settings from July 2025 through June 2028.

This solution consists of “NEUROPHET Inc. TesLab,” a brain imaging treatment planning software, and “NEUROPHET Ink,” an electrical stimulation device. It analyzes the patient’s MRI to create a 3D brain model and automatically designs the optimal stimulation location and intensity. Conventional tDCS showed significant variations in effectiveness due to differences in brain structure among patients, but this solution is evaluated to have precisely overcome that limitation.

CEO Bin emphasized, “Only our personalized stimulation showed statistically significant results,” adding, “On the Modified Barthel Index, which evaluates rehabilitation outcomes, we recorded a score of 11.25, exceeding the target score of 9.25.” He further noted, “While sham stimulation and standard coordinate-based stimulation produced random effects, only personalized stimulation—which takes the patient’s brain structure into account—demonstrated clear improvement.”

NEUROPHET Inc. has been building a body of clinical evidence for patients undergoing stroke rehabilitation, those with finger motor paralysis, and those with impaired consciousness. Recently, the company expanded its indications to include dysphagia (swallowing disorders). This decision was based on the fact that dysphagia occurs in 50–73% of stroke patients, and for half of them, it leads to complications such as aspiration pneumonia, making it a major cause of death.

Actual revenue began to materialize in earnest starting this past March, following the commencement of clinical use in July of last year. CEO Bin said, “We estimated that it would take at least one year for hospitals to adopt a new medical device, and that’s exactly how it played out.” Currently, more than 15 hospitals have adopted the device; half are tertiary general hospitals, such as university hospitals, and the other half are specialized rehabilitation hospitals. Samsung Seoul Hospital is reportedly the first to have adopted it.

Treatment costs vary by hospital. CEO Bin explained, “We break even with just three patients,” adding, “Unlike conventional occupational therapy, this treatment is impossible without our device, so the decision to adopt it is intuitive from the hospital’s perspective.”

The Only Digital Therapeutic for Stroke in Korea... Strengths Compared to Competitors

NEUROPHET Inc. made it clear that it is not in direct competition with established leaders in the stroke field, such as the U.S.-based Rapid and JLK, Inc. While those companies focus on diagnosis, NEUROPHET Inc. emphasizes rehabilitation therapy. CEO Bin drew a clear distinction, stating, “We’re different because our imaging is for treatment, not diagnosis,” and added, “It’s appropriate to focus on treatment for stroke at this time.”

The biggest difference between NeuroFit and its domestic competitors, REMED CO.,LTD. and YBrain (MindStream), is the presence or absence of navigation software. CEO Bin said, “As far as I know, they are not yet engaged in stroke rehabilitation, and we are the only ones doing so.” He added, “Our differentiation strategy is to target severe diseases first, where treatment efficacy can only be proven with navigation software.” Regarding ZBrain, which develops digital therapeutics for Parkinson’s disease, he noted, “Brain disorders differ in terms of affected regions and electrical stimulation mechanisms,” and therefore did not view them as direct competitors.

Comparing the company to a Spanish firm with similar technology, he emphasized, “They remain in the research phase, charging $500 per case to create personalized models based on MRI scans,” while noting, “Our system is fully automated, allowing medical staff to use it immediately on-site.”

The company is also preparing to enter the U.S. market. CEO Bin noted, “Since this is a new medical device in the U.S. as well, we are preparing through the de novo track,” adding, “It took 10 years in Korea because we were the first in the world, but we expect to shorten that timeline somewhat in the U.S.” Reimbursement is expected to take at least 4–6 years, as the technology must undergo a three-year evaluation period for innovative medical technologies followed by a new medical technology assessment after 2028.

Regarding existing diagnostic AI products, collaboration with big pharma is ongoing. The company has completed technical validation with Eli Lilly and has entered the stage of reviewing actual clinical data, aiming to submit a joint paper by the end of this year. It is also collaborating with Eisai Korea to quickly identify patients eligible for early-stage treatment.
